We work across London and further afield on events, film and TV locations, studios and construction sites. The work is hard and the hours can vary drastically each week. The team are rarely in the same place from one day to the next. A typical job could include:
- Building sets and stages for a festival
- Loading tonnes and tonnes of flight cases and equipment onto trucks
- Setting up furniture, screens and sound systems for a conference at a 5* hotel
- Installing modular systems on a construction site
- Moving scenery and props on a film set, we need people who:
